cnc machining center CNC (Computer Numerical Control) machining is uniquely positioned to meet the stringent demands of the EV market. Unlike traditional automotive parts, EV components often require complex geometries, lightweight materials, and exceptionally tight tolerances to ensure efficiency, safety, and performance. Key areas where CNC machining excels include:
EMotor Housings and Components: The heart of an EV, the electric motor, requires precisely machined housings for optimal heat dissipation and stator/rotor alignment. CNC milling and turning produce these critical parts from aluminum or copper alloys with the necessary thermal and electrical properties.
Battery Enclosures: The battery pack is the most vital and vulnerable system in an EV. Its enclosure must be rigid, lightweight, and thermally managed. CNC machining creates robust, sealed housings from aluminum or advanced composites, often integrating complex cooling channels directly into the design.
Power Electronics and Heat Sinks: Inverters and DCDC converters manage high power loads, generating significant heat. Highprecision CNC machining produces intricate heat sinks with large surface areas from materials like copper or aluminum to efficiently dissipate this heat, ensuring system longevity.
Lightweight Structural Components: To offset battery weight and maximize range, EVs utilize lightweight materials. CNC machining is ideal for creating strong, complex brackets, suspension components, and chassis parts from aluminum and other advanced alloys.
